I call this the 25,000 Dollar pizza interview.The following interview with Gail Churrinnetz is from a few years ago and is one of my favorite pizza conversations. Gail had just won the Food Networks Ultimate Recipe Showdown, hosted by Guy Fieri. She won by creating a crawfish and andouille Sausage Pizza.The incredible thing is that in the middle of filming here episodes in New York she drove to Sally's Apizza in New Haven to use the water in her award-winning pie.This interview adds fuel to the endless debate over whether water does make a difference in making great pizza.Gail is a professional chef, as well as an instructor. She also worked at ACH Food companies helping to develop and refine recipes She was the winner of Pizza Therapy's Pizza Competition, as well a regular chef guest on local CBS affiliate morning show and food writer for Germantown News in Tennessee Currently, she has an “in-home” pizza party business.     This is Episode 3 of the Pizza Therapy Podcast.All Show Notes on this page:https://apizzapodcast.com/episode-3-al-santillo-of-santillos-brick-oven-pizza/My name is Albert Grande and in this episode, I speak with Al Santillo of Santillo's Brick Oven Pizza located in Elizabeth New Jersey.Al is a 3rd generation pizza maker who carries on the tradition of making great pizza. He reveals the secret to his pizza is the original pizza recipe handed down through generations. One of the secrets is the brick oven which was a a coal-fired oven but has been converted to gas. He is an old-school pizza maker who is dedicated to the craft of pizza making. Al is a no-nonsense guy who shares his passion through his pizza and proudly “tells it like it is.”.     Complete Show Notes and Video Resources can be found at:https://apizzapodcast.com/episode-2-jonathan-goldsmith-of-spacca-napoli/Jonathan explains his path to pizza and why he decided to pursue his goal of opening an authentic Neapolitan pizzeria in the mecca of Chicago Deep dish. While in Florence Italy on the Adriatic coast he was advised to go west…that is to Naples to learn all about pizza.Jonathan believes he is part of a guild of pizza makers. You don't learn to make pizza in a couple of weeks or even months. He feels his pizza making is always changing and he just wants to make pizza better.He gives a nod to who he thinks are the greatest pizza masters in America: Roberto Caporuscio, Tony Gemignani as well as Chris Bianco. Jonathan explains how he wants Spacca Napoli to serve his community, his customers and his staff. He talks his inspiration for the pizzas he makes and explains his excitement of being motivated by other great pizza makers. He also shares some pizza tips for the home pizza maker and what has changed with his own dough formula.Interestingly he reveals the secret of the digestibility of pizza.At the end of our conversation he gives shout outs to John Arena of Metro Pizza, Michele D'Amelio, Giulio Adriani, and Roberto Carporuscio.
